"PALIMPSESTO"  at Museo Iloilo (June 29 - July 28, 2005)


Museo Iloilo

Our Streamer



The collective artists statement, written by myself and Nong Liby Limoso.


The Exhibit in Museo Iloilo



THE ARTWORKS OF PALIMPSESTO

Christian Evren "VanS3n" Lozañes



"Ang Akon Paglagaw sa Plasa"
Acrylic on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


"Enes"
Acrylic on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


Goldberg "AtariBetch" Villanueva


"Siesta"
Acrylic on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


"Vandal Ko"
Acrylic on Canvas  (4ft x 3ft)


Norman Posecion


"Estorya Sang Daan Nga Espejo"
Oil on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


"Tabon ng Tabon"
Oil on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


Kristine Garcia


"Kutso-kutso"
Oil on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


Jorell Demapindan


"Fixed Chord Blueprint"
Acrylic on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


"Stapled Blueprint"
Acrylic on Canvas  (3ft x 4ft)


Liby Limoso


"Bulawan nga Sabot"
Oil on Canvas  (4ft x 3ft)


"Kadlum"
Installation (Bermuda Grass, Human Hair & Dog Bones) 3ft x 10ft
